Course Description
This course is divided into 6 sections whereby each section consists of three to eigth lectures. Each lecture has a duration of 3 to 15 minutes where the most time I'll show and explain you different topics directly in the software. Additionally, this course contains a comprehensive and continious exerciese project, so each section ends with some exercises where you can apply what you have learnt.
Section 1 Introduction gives you a short introduction and overview of the course
Section 2 deals about how to setup, create and plan Jobs in Business Central.
In Section 3 we continue with posting costs to Jobs.
Section 4 concerns with the reveneu side and explains how to invoice Jobs and calculate Work in Progress.
In Section 5, to close the circle, we will go through how to analyse Jobs in Business Central.
Finally, we will end the course with a conclusion in section 6.
The Job module in Business Central helps companies to gain more transparency in their tasks and projects about actual and planned costs, revenues and invoices for each of their Jobs.
